Biomedical Technologist Jobs in Mount Pleasant, SC
A Biomedical Technologist in the med tech industry is responsible for maintaining, repairing, and calibrating medical equipment and devices. They ensure that these critical tools function correctly to produce accurate and reliable patient data. They may also be involved in the installation and testing of new devices, as well as training medical personnel in the proper use of the equipment. Biomedical Technologists often work closely with other medical professionals including doctors, nurses, and medical laboratory technologists to ensure the most beneficial patient outcomes.
Potential candidates for this role should have a strong background in electronics and medical equipment technology. They should have strong problem-solving skills and be adept at troubleshooting complex issues. In addition, they should be knowledgeable about healthcare regulations and safety standards. Certifications such as Certified Biomedical Equipment Technician (CBET), Certified Laboratory Equipment Specialist (CLES), or Certified Radiology Equipment Specialist (CRES) are highly valuable. Before becoming a Biomedical Technologist, a person may have roles such as Biomedical Equipment Technician, Medical Equipment Repairer, or even a Medical Laboratory Technician.
